About This Book

This volume examines Kierkegaard's Two Ages within the broader context of his philosophical writings.

Lee C. Barrett provides analysis suited for students and researchers interested in Kierkegaard's thought.

The discussion situates the text among Kierkegaard's other works and key philosophical themes.
